Adaptable Design for Diverse Terrains
Robust Mobility on Uneven Surfaces
Self loading mixers are engineered with high ground clearance, all-wheel drive, and torque-heavy engines that excel in difficult site conditions. Whether navigating steep inclines, muddy pathways, or unfinished terrain, these machines maintain mobility without compromising stability.
The ergonomic cab positioning also allows better line-of-sight for operators, reducing incidents and enabling precise maneuvering in tight zones — a common scenario in residential or hill-slope developments.
Operational Flexibility Across Projects
From backyard extensions to large-scale infrastructure developments, self loading mixers transition seamlessly between applications. Their drum capacity, often ranging from 1.2 to 6.5 cubic meters, provides scalability. They can pour slabs for villas one day and fill foundations for telecom towers the next.
Because the mixing drum can rotate 270 degrees or more, contractors can discharge concrete in narrow alleys or over embankments without needing additional conveyors or manual handling. This dramatically improves labor efficiency and reduces material wastage.
Integrated Functions for Productivity Gains
Batching, Mixing, and Transport — All in One
Unlike traditional setups that require multiple machines and labor coordination, the self loading mixer centralizes operations. Its integrated batching system measures and loads materials accurately, while the drum begins mixing en route to the pouring location. Water tanks and a digital control panel further automate mixing ratios.
This system eliminates errors caused by manual batching and ensures consistency across every load. It also enables just-in-time concrete production — ideal for projects requiring small but frequent pours.

Cost-Efficiency Over the Project Lifecycle
Reduced Manpower and Equipment Costs
Hiring separate transit mixers, pumps, and batch plants often inflates a project’s initial investment. By replacing three machines with one, the self loading concrete mixer in Ghana offers a leaner setup. Fewer operators are needed. Fewer logistics are involved.
Over time, the reduction in fuel usage, equipment maintenance, and handling overheads translates into substantial lifecycle savings. Contractors also sidestep delays caused by waiting for external batching or delivery services.
Durability Minimizes Downtime
Built with reinforced steel drums, industrial-grade chassis, and high-efficiency hydraulics, these machines endure rugged work environments. Their maintenance schedule is minimal, thanks to centralized grease points, automatic alerts, and diagnostic systems.
When properly maintained, a self loading mixer becomes a long-term asset — not just a short-term solution. It adapts to shifting project demands while maintaining reliability and performance across seasons.
